I had a similar bug. When the bug occurred I had a ServerName listed in
my /etc/cups/client.conf that was nonexistent/inaccessible . I commented
out the SeverName line in the client.conf file and this bug disappeared.

I would like to add that this only occurs when attempting to connect to
wireless networks that have multiple access-points broadcasting the same
ssid. I cannot connect at my schools library which has 10+ wireless aps
all on the same ssid, though I can connect to networks that only have 1.
